Six Barcelona players shine as Spain seal a 3-0 win
The young central defender continues to grow into one of Spain’s most promising defensive prospects. He is valued for his calmness on the ball, smart positioning and assurance when carrying possession, and his performances have made him a significant option for both Barcelona and the Spanish national team.
Pedri remains among Spain’s most influential midfielders. His standout traits include sharp awareness, a wide passing range and the ability to steer the rhythm of a match, and he featured again as Spain secured the victory over Austria.
Olmo added creativity and attacking intelligence to Spain’s side. Able to operate across multiple forward roles, the Barcelona midfielder is known for generating chances, knitting together play in the attacking third, and contributing with key goals and assists.
The teenage sensation is continuing to meet the high expectations placed on him. With exceptional dribbling, real pace and confidence, Yamal remains one of the most exciting young talents in global football, and he played his part in Spain’s win.
Gavi’s relentless approach and competitive edge continue to make him one of Spain’s most reliable midfield performers. His aggressive pressing, high energy and technical ability provide balance and intensity whenever he takes the field.
Ferran Torres brought experience and additional attacking depth to Spain’s front line. He can be used across the width of the attack, and he remains an important figure for both Barcelona and the national team due to his intelligent movement, finishing quality and versatility.
Barcelona’s national-team footprint continues to grow
Spain’s match against Austria underlined the club’s lasting influence on the national setup, with a mix of established internationals and rising stars from Barcelona combining to help deliver the result.
